Versions Compared

Key

  • This line was added.
  • This line was removed.
  • Formatting was changed.
Table of Contents

...

Info

This

...

section describes how to manage datastore tiers to offer storage service levels in private cloud datacenters.

...

Introduction to datastore tiers

In private cloud, to group hypervisor datastores and price them according to service levels, use datastore tiers. 

  • When you use tiers, administrators or cloud users can choose the service level for VM hard disks at the level of VM templates, virtual datacenters, and VMs. 

  • When you perform VM or storage moves outside of Abiquo, the platform will synchronize disks to their new datastore tiers.

  • If you do not enable datastore tiers feature, all datastore disks will be created in the "Default Tier".

You can add datastores to a tier when you add a hypervisor to the platform, or from the Datastore tiers tab.

  • You can only add datastores to datastore tiers if they do not have any managed VM disks on them or if none of the disks are in a tier.

To restrict the use of datastore tiers, you can make them:

  • Not allowed: an enterprise cannot use a tier that is not allowed, and they cannot create disks in this tier.

  • Disabled: the administrator can disable a tier, for example, for maintenance, migration, or administrative reasons.

In widgets on the Dashboard, the platform will display tiers that are allowed, and tiers that are disabled.

Display datastore tiers

To display datastore tiers for hypervisor storage service levels:

  1. Go to Infrastructure → Private 

  2. Select a datacenter

  3. Go to Servers view → Datastore tiers

...

To manage the datastores of the hypervisor in tiers: 

  1. Go to Servers

  2. Edit the hypervisor

To display a list of enterprises with access to a datastore tier, edit the tier and go to Enterprise access.

When you deploy VMs, the platform will copy VM templates to the hypervisor datastore and you can also create hard disks and allow users to create hard disks on the hypervisor datastores.

To create combine storage service levels across the cloud to set cloud storage limits for tenants, use abstract datastore tiers.
For details of how to create policy with datastore tiers, see Manage datastore storage policies
For a general introduction, see About datastore tiers and About abstract datastore tiers

...

Create datastore tiers

To create a datastore tier:

Panel
bgColor#FFFAE6

Privileges: Access infrastructure view and Private DCs, View datacenter details, Manage storage elements

  1. Go to InfrastructurePrivate

...

  1. Select a datacenter and go to Datastore tiers

  2. Click the +

...

  1. add button

  2. Enter the Name and Description

  3. Optionally, select an Abstract datastore tier to add the tier to a group to control storage service levels for tenants in more than one datacenter. See 

...

  1. Manage datastore

...

  1. storage

...

  1. policies

  2. Click Save

The platform will create the tier and allow access to all future enterprises that you create. 

...

Set access to tier service levels for datastores

Excerpt
nameSet access to tier service levels for datastores

This section describes how to define access to datastore tiers.

When you create a datastore tier, by default the platform will allow access to the current enterprise only.

To allow access to different service levels you can set access for these levels:

  • all enterprises

  • enterprises in a datacenter

To modify enterprise access for

...

all enterprises:

  1. To modify enterprise access for all enterprises,

  2. Go to Infrastructure → Private

...

  1. Select a datacenter and go to Datastore tiers

  2. Create or edit datastore tier

...

  1. and go to Enterprise access

  2. Select Allow all enterprises or Restrict all enterprises

Note
  • Changes here will override the settings defined for an individual enterprise

  • You cannot restrict the access of enterprises that have already created disks in the tier

...

Set access to a datastore tierImage Added

To display a list of enterprises that currently have access to a datastore tier:

  1. To modify enterprise access for all enterprises,

  2. Go to Infrastructure → Private

...

  1. Select a datacenter and go to Datastore tiers

  2. Create or edit datastore tier

...

  1. and go to Enterprise access

  2. Click Cancel or select Do not change enterprise access

...

  1. Display a list of all enterprises with accessImage Added

...

Allow a tenant to use datastore tiers in a datacenter

Excerpt
nameAllow a tenant to use datastore tiers in a datacenter

You can control access to datastore service levels with datastore tiers. 

To allow or prohibit access to a datastore tier for an individual enterprise

  1. Go to Users

...

  1. andedit an enterprise

  2. Go to Datacenters and edit an allowed datacenter

  3. Go to Datastore tiers

  4. Drag datastore tiers to the Allowed or Prohibited lists for this enterprise

  5. Click Accept to save the Enterprise datacenter resources

...

 Allow an enterprise to use datastore tiersImage Added

You can also set limits for the tenant for the datastore tiers within each datacenter. See Configure an enterprise in a cloud

...

location

Note

Troubleshooting

  • You cannot restrict the access of enterprises that have already created disks in the tier

  • Changes in Infrastructure view to the Datastore tiers on the Enterprise access tab will override these settings

...

Edit a datastore tier and add multiple datastores

Excerpt
nameEdit a datastore tier and add multiple datastores

You can edit a datastore tier and select multiple hypervisor datastores to add them to this service level.

To add multiple datastores to a tier:

  1. Go to InfrastructurePrivate

...

  1. Select a datacenter and go to Datastore tiers 

  2. Select a datastore tier

...

  1. In the

...

  1. Datastores pane on the right

...

  1. , click the + add button

     Add multiple datastores to a tierImage Added
  2. From the popup list, select the

...

  1. datastores to add

...

  1.  Select datastores to add to a tierImage Added
  2. Click Add

Note

Troubleshooting

  • Generally, you cannot add datastores with managed VMs deployed on them to a datastore tier

  • Exception: if a datastore with managed VMs deployed on it does not have a tier (e.g. as a result of datastore synchronization), you can assign it to a tier and the platform will automatically assign all disks to that tier

You can also add datastore tiers to services levels when you create or edit a hypervisor. See Compute in datacenters